PROBLEM TO BE SOLVED: To suppress the deformation of a sheet by minimizing a camber by cooling which is generated during the cooling and to surely execute draining by minimizing the clearance generated between a restraining drain roll and a steel sheet. SOLUTION: This method is a cooling method of a high-temp. steel sheet by which cooling is on-line executed while passing through between plural pairs of restraining rolls and the cooling is executed by adding constraint force larger than the constraint force P per one restraining roll shown by formula, P=CDcv t<2> L<0.65> (W/4000)<2> . In the above formula, C is a constant (=5×10<-5> ), Dcv is a temp. gradient ( deg.C/m), (t) is sheet thickness (mm), L is distance between the restraining rolls (m) and W is width (mm).
